Copenhagen climate summit fails green investors

BBC News reports here: The biggest step Copenhagen could have taken to stimulate the green economy would have been to send a strong signal that the price of carbon dioxide pollution will rise. Airlines and power companies, for example, don’t yet know whether upgrading to cleaner technology will be economically worthwhile.

The Developing World Finds Its Voice

Spiegel Online reports here: Some of the world’s largest developing nations met over the weekend to form a collective bargaining position ahead of the Copenhagen climate summit, which starts next week. Their demand? More money from the West. Read SPIEGEL ONLINE’s Climate Countdown to keep up to date as Copenhagen approaches.

Copenhagen climate summit: 60 world leaders to attend

BBC News reports here: Hopes for the Copenhagen climate summit in December have been boosted after it emerged more than 60 presidents and prime ministers planned to attend. Planning to attend: Leaders of Britain, Germany, France, Spain, Australia, Japan, Indonesia and Brazil, Yet to commit: Leaders of the United States, China and India.
